Residential cleaning business software organizes the specific rhythm of house cleaning: recurring customers on fixed intervals, frequent reschedules, access notes that matter, and hourly crews whose time has to be recorded accurately. CleanPilotPro handles recurring job series, cleaner assignments with availability checks, customer reminders, job notes, checklists and photos, job-based clock-in and clock-out, weekly payroll and per-job invoicing — with a mobile app for crews and a web dashboard for the office.

What is residential cleaning business software?

It is the system that holds your residential customer base, the recurring schedule those customers sit on, the cleaners assigned to each visit, and the record of what was actually done. Compared with commercial work, residential operations involve smaller jobs, more of them, more reschedules and more direct customer contact — so reminders, job notes and per-visit documentation carry more weight than contract paperwork.

Recurring weekly, biweekly and monthly customers

Create each customer's visit once with its interval, day, arrival window, expected hours, crew size and price, and the series generates. Editing the series updates upcoming visits while completed history stays intact — so a price change or a permanent day change does not require touching dozens of individual jobs.

Cleaner assignments and schedule changes

Residential schedules move constantly: customers travel, cleaners call out, a deep clean runs long. Assign from a searchable cleaner picker, get warned when someone is off or already booked, and reassign in a tap — the affected cleaner sees the change on their phone rather than in a group text.

Job notes, checklists and photos

House cleaning quality depends on details a substitute cleaner cannot guess: which products to use, where the key is, which room to skip. Job notes travel with the account, checklist templates keep scope consistent, and photos document the finished result — including after completion, when a customer follows up later.

Clock-in, payroll and invoicing

Cleaners clock in and out against each assigned job from the mobile app, and completing the job clocks them out automatically. Those hours aggregate into a weekly payroll view per employee, with cash and direct-deposit splits supported. On the billing side, invoices are generated per job and payment methods — card, Zelle, cash or invoice — are recorded.
